在MYSQL里select  isnull  会报错   解决:换成 ifnull 就可以了语句如下:select ifnull(name,0) from tablename   这是查询,如果要将数据库字段更新,语句如下 update tableable set tableablename=
转载 2023-06-05 14:07:53
197阅读
# MySQL修改结构允许字段为null 在数据库设计中,有时候需要修改结构来允许某个字段可以为null。这种情况可能是因为业务需求的变更或者数据录入的灵活性要求。在MySQL中,我们可以通过ALTER TABLE语句来修改结构,使得字段可以为空。 ## ALTER TABLE语句 ALTER TABLE语句用于修改现有的结构,包括增加、删除和修改字段等操作。要允许字段为null,我
原创 2024-03-10 06:49:35
252阅读
# 将MySQL中的空值修改nullMySQL数据库中,空值和null是不同的概念。空值指的是字段未被填充任何数据,而null表示该字段的值为未知或不存在。在某些情况下,我们可能需要将中的空值转换为null,以便更好地处理数据和查询结果。本文将介绍如何通过SQL语句将MySQL中的空值修改null。 ## 为什么需要将空值修改null 在数据库中,空值和null是不同的概念,
原创 2024-03-22 07:26:53
262阅读
```mermaid journey title 修改字段 null 流程 section 步骤 开始 --> 获取结构信息 --> 编写修改字段语句 --> 执行sql语句 --> 结束 ``` ```mermaid flowchart TD subgraph 修改字段 null 流程 开始 --> 获取结构信息 --> 编写修改字段
原创 2024-05-07 03:49:29
39阅读
### 修改MySQL字段not null的流程 要修改MySQL字段not null,需要经过以下步骤: | 步骤 | 操作 | | ------ | ------ | | 1 | 连接到MySQL数据库 | | 2 | 找到需要修改 | | 3 | 修改字段的定义 | | 4 | 修改已存在的数据 | | 5 | 验证修改是否成功 | 下面我将详细解释每个步骤需要做什么,并提供相应的
原创 2023-08-30 03:04:30
152阅读
# MySQL修改字段not null 在数据库设计中,我们经常需要修改结构,包括修改字段的属性。有时候,在创建时,我们可能会忽略某些字段的约束条件,比如忘记设置字段为not null。而在后续的开发过程中,我们可能会发现这个问题并希望将这些字段设置为not null。本文将介绍如何使用MySQL修改字段的not null属性。 ## 1. 查看表结构 在进行任何修改之前,我们首先需要
原创 2024-01-10 06:53:51
180阅读
# 如何修改MySQL字段的null值 ## 简介 在MySQL数据库中,我们经常需要修改的字段属性,包括将字段的null值属性从允许为null改为不允许为null,或者反之。本文将介绍如何使用MySQL语句来修改字段的null值属性。 ## 流程图 ```mermaid flowchart TD Start[开始] --> ConnectMySQL[连接MySQL数据库]
原创 2023-12-07 03:29:27
92阅读
# 如何实现“mysql修改跳过null” ## 整体流程 首先,我们需要判断要修改的字段值是否为`NULL`,如果是,则跳过该字段的更新操作;如果不是,则执行更新操作。 下面是整个流程的步骤表格: | 步骤 | 操作 | | --- | --- | | 1 | 判断字段值是否为`NULL` | | 2 | 如果是`NULL`,跳过更新操作 | | 3 | 如果不是`NULL`,执行更新操
原创 2024-05-14 06:30:56
38阅读
创建数据基本语法:1 create table 数据名称( 2 字段名称 字段类型 字段约束, 3 ... 4 )[选项];字段类型整数型1 tinyint :占用1个字节的长度,无符号型,可以表示0-255,有符号型,可以表示-128-127 2 smallint :占用2个字节的长度,无符号型,可以表示0-65535,有符号型,可以表示-32768-32767 3
转载 2023-08-24 10:18:07
122阅读
# 如何修改MySQL中的Null属性 ## 引言 在MySQL数据库中,每个列都有一个属性来定义是否允许为空。当一个列允许为空时,它可以存储NULL值,表示该列没有值。在某些情况下,我们可能需要修改中的列的Null属性。本文将介绍如何修改MySQL中列的Null属性,并提供一个实际问题的解决方案和示例。 ## 实际问题 假设我们有一个名为"customers"的,其中有一个列名为"
原创 2024-01-17 09:05:26
134阅读
# MySQL 修改字段text NULL MySQL是一个广泛使用的开源关系型数据库管理系统,在数据库设计中经常需要对字段进行修改。本文介绍了如何使用MySQL修改字段为text类型,并设置为可为空。 ## 1. 准备工作 在开始修改字段之前,我们需要先确保数据库已经创建,并且包含需要修改。假设我们的数据库名为`mydatabase`,名为`mytable`。 ## 2. 查看字段
原创 2023-12-02 06:34:51
237阅读
## MySQL修改字段为NOT NULL的流程 在MySQL中,要将一个字段修改为NOT NULL,需要经过以下几个步骤: 1. 创建备份:在进行任何修改之前,首先要对数据库进行备份,以防止操作过程中出现意外情况导致数据丢失。 2. 检查约束:如果字段已经存在约束(如外键约束),需要先将约束删除或修改,否则无法修改字段为NOT NULL。 3. 修改字段定义:使用ALTER TABLE语
原创 2023-10-27 06:35:11
297阅读
# MySQL日期修改null的实现方法 ## 引言 在MySQL数据库中,有时候我们需要将日期字段的值修改NULL,特别是在数据清洗或者数据迁移的过程中。本文将向你介绍如何使用SQL语句将MySQL日期字段修改NULL。 ## 流程概述 下面是将MySQL日期字段修改NULL的流程概述: | 步骤 | 说明 | | ------ | ------ | | 1 | 连接到MySQL
原创 2023-09-10 17:37:13
346阅读
# MySQL 修改字段为NULL 在数据库开发过程中,经常会遇到需要修改字段为NULL的情况。 MySQL是一个流行的关系型数据库管理系统,提供了方便的工具和语法来处理这类问题。本文将介绍如何使用MySQL修改字段为NULL,并提供相应的代码示例。 ## 修改字段为NULL的步骤 要将一个字段设置为可以存储NULL值,需要经过以下步骤: 1. **连接到MySQL数据库**:首先需要连
原创 2024-05-03 05:22:09
172阅读
# MySQL修改字段为NOT NULL MySQL是一个开源的关系型数据库管理系统,广泛用于各种规模的应用程序中。在数据库设计和维护过程中,经常需要对字段进行修改。本文将重点介绍如何在MySQL修改字段为NOT NULL。 ## 什么是NOT NULL约束 在数据库中,NOT NULL约束用于限制字段的取值不能为NULLNULL表示缺失或未知的值,而NOT NULL则表示字段必须有一
原创 2023-08-28 03:38:57
335阅读
经常用mysql的人可能会遇到下面几种情况: 1、我字段类型是not null,为什么我可以插入空值 2、为什么not null的效率比null高 3、判断字段不为空的时候,到底要用 select * from table where column <> ” 还是要用 select * from table where column is not null 呢。 带着上面几个疑问,我
转载 2023-08-31 18:44:59
53阅读
NULL 为什么这么经常用(1) java的nullnull是一个让人头疼的问题,比如java中的NullPointerException。为了避免猝不及防的空指针,需要小心翼翼地各种if判断,麻烦又臃肿.为此有很多的开源包都有诸多处理common lang3的StringUtils.isBlank();   CollectionUtils.isEmpty();guava的
作为开发人员,我们经常需要设计数据库,这个时候我们需要考虑使用字段使用哪种数据类型,以及默认值,字符集等等一些问题,我们今天就来探讨下字段为啥尽量设置为NOT NULL。简介如果一个字段设置为NOT NULL ,表明我们在写数据时,在没有默认值的情况下,不能写入一个空值 例如:create table friends (id int(3) not null,name varchar(8) not
下文为基于客户&商品的Mysql关系型数据库的数据文件的导入、连接查询以及查询结果导出的相关说明。一、「原始分类数据属性概览」据统计,`22 category201812141850`中共包含有3847种商品类别,3319个类别名称,797个父类ID(基于已有类别的再划分)。分别对应记录:3847条CATEGORY_ID、3847条CATEGORY_NO、3319条CATEGORY_NAM
转载 2024-07-18 20:39:50
23阅读
Mysql数据库是一个基于结构化数据的开源数据库。SQL语句是MySQL数据库中核心语言。不过在MySQL数据库中执行SQL语句,需要小心两个陷阱。   陷阱一:空值不一定为空  空值是一个比较特殊的字段。在MySQL数据库中,在不同的情形下,空值往往代表不同的含义。这是MySQL数据库的一种特性。如在普通的字段中(字符型的数据),空值就是表示空值。但是如果将一个空值的数据插入到TimesTamp
转载 2024-08-08 12:06:18
59阅读
  • 1
  • 2
  • 3
  • 4
  • 5